    In 1958, in rural Georgia sits a little town, Eden Grove, and on hundreds of acres of land sits the Eden Grove Orchard, the most successful peach farm in the Deep South. The townsfolk say its luscious peaches are larger than life, and people come from across the country to buy. The fruit itself is impossibly sweet, and the orchard has survived countless droughts that destroyed many neighboring farms. The owners, the Beaumont family, have become one of the richest Black families in Georgia despite living through generations of discrimination, violence, and many attempts to drive them from the land. Everyone envies them, some publicly, some privately. Nobody understands them either. And nobody is allowed into the Orchard after dark.

    After the State orders troubled teenager Jo Spencer into Deep Sleep, an experimental rehabilitation program that promises to erase destructive behavior, she awakens one year later with fractured memories and a growing sense that something is terribly wrong. As she struggles to piece together her past, impossible recollections begin surfacing: gruesome events no one else remembers, missing pieces of her identity, and whispers that patients who enter Deep Sleep don't always come back the same. On the day of her rebirthday, every recovered memory deepens her suspicion that the treatment changed far more than her behavior. But the most terrifying question isn't what happened while she was asleep.
